the code I want to explain at the basics that you need to understand for this

tutorial so let's say that already you have one login page and here you have

one email one password I want a login button and here you have

some page that you want to be hidden let's say index.PHP and you want

that this page is only visible to the people who are logged in so what we are

going to do first we will add organize Facebook button and when someone click

on this button they will redirect that person to the Facebook so let's say this

is Facebook and now on the Facebook the visitor will have to accept the

permissions for our application and once he accept or even cancel the permissions

we will redirect people from the Facebook to our one page this one let's

say Facebook callback page and now on this page we are going to check

everything that happened on this on the Facebook and if the person has allowed

us to get all the information that we need from his profile

we will redirect him to this secret page and if there is any error on this page

and if the person didn't allow us permissions we are going to redirect him

back to the login page so now this may seem a little bit complicated for

you but actually the code is really simple and all you need to do is that we

need to add one login additional button redirect to the Facebook and this fire

builders process for the date so let me now show you how to write the code so

and permissions that you are going to need let me quickly explain you

what are the permissions so if we go here this is rough API Explorer and if

we try to submit we wanted to get ID in the name as you can see here it stays an

active access token must be used to query information about the current user

which means that first we need to get access token and based on that access

token depends what we can get from the Facebook so if we go here to the get

token and go to get user access token we can see here the list of holder of all

the permissions that exists on the Facebook so if we do not include any of

those it means that we will get the public profile which include us ID and

the name but if we want to get let's say before we try that out us click here hit

submit again and as you can see this ID is this and the name is this and now if

I try to get an email hit enter as you can see the email is not included and

here it says the file email is only accessible etc etc and we can include by

going to the get get you ready stokin include this

permission hit get access token we will need to approve again that we will give

to the graph API Explorer our email and if we try now you can see that an email

has been included so those are the permissions that we will always need to

specify and since the public profile so already cool I will just see here that

we need email too and last thing is to get login URL so it was helper get log

in URL already wrecked URL we have define and permissions are defined - and

now if I just echo login URL let's see what we will get
